NONSYLLABIC

I. (adjective)
Sense 1
Meaning:
(of speech sounds) not forming or capable of forming the nucleus of a syllable
Example:
initial 'l' in 'little' is nonsyllabic

Sense 2
Meaning:
Not forming a syllable or the nucleus of a syllable; consisting of a consonant sound accompanied in the same syllable by a vowel sound or consisting of a vowel sound dominated by other vowel sounds in a syllable (as the second vowel in a falling diphthong)
Example:
the nonsyllabic 'i' in 'oi'
